How to prevent photovoltaic panels from slipping in the snow

How to prevent photovoltaic panels from slipping in the snow

Key protective measures include selecting modules rated for at least 5000 Pa load capacity in heavy snow regions, implementing tilt angles of 30 to 35 degrees for optimal snow shedding, elevating systems at least two feet above maximum snow depth, and designing foundations.

There are wrinkles on the back of the photovoltaic panel

There are wrinkles on the back of the photovoltaic panel

What it looks like: Faint, shallow wrinkles, often in the margin of the module and far from any active cells or electrical connections. These are almost always harmless aesthetic issues. The structural integrity and insulation of the backsheet are not.

Photovoltaic panel support loading

Photovoltaic panel support loading

ASCE 7-16 defines the weight of solar panels, their support system, and ballast as dead load. Load combinations must be used in structural calculations. 2) ASCE 7-16 requires modeling for live load offsets under various conditions.
